Could this surprise candiate replace Lewis Hamilton? 'My eyes are on F1'

2023 Formula 2 vice-champion Frederik Vesti has reiterated his intention to move to Formula 1. The 22-year-old is currently competing in the European Le Mans Series in the 'really competitive' LMP2 class with Cool Racing, but the Dane has been eying a possible F1 seat for 2025. Mercedes test and reserve driver Vesti hopes that there will be an opportunity for him to show his talent. Could this be at the vacant Mercedes seat next to George Russell?
